Q: What is the rear diff oil capacity of 01'dodge ram 1500?

What is fluid capacity of a ford 8.8 rear diff?

The standard capacity is about 2 quarts and you will need to put in a bottle of friction modifier. When you fill it up, it should reach to the bottom of the fill hole, with the vehicle at normal ride height.
